RCV-Snyder County to replay game at 7:30

Last updated: July 7, 2017 - 5:13pm


BLOOMSBURG — Two Little League all-star teams whose Wednesday game ended in a controversial umpire call – followed by accusations of name-calling and animosity – will replay the game tonight at 7:30 p.m. here.

But it's not because of the call. Instead, Little League said three players on the Roaring Creek Valley team weren't eligible to play on an all-star team because they hadn't played enough regular season games.

So tonight, the team from southern Columbia County will face Snyder County's team without those three players. The winner of tonight's game will play South Columbia on Saturday.
